Profile

Professor Ng Wai Hoe is currently the Group Chief Executive Officer (CEO) at SingHealth and Senior Consultant with the Department of Neurosurgery at National Neuroscience Institute (NNI). He was previously Deputy Group CEO (Strategy & Planning) of SingHealth, CEO of Changi General Hospital, Medical Director of NNI, Academic Chair of the SingHealth Duke-NUS Neuroscience Academic Clinical Programme as well as Deputy Chairman of the SingHealth Medical Board.

Prof Ng is a neurosurgeon with clinical interests in neurosurgical oncology (brain tumours), stereotactic and functional neurosurgery and epilepsy surgery.

He was a Fellow of the Royal Australasian College of Surgeons (FRACS) and underwent residency training in Singapore (NNI) and Australia (Royal Melbourne Hospital and Royal Children's Hospital). He underwent subspecialty training at the Royal Melbourne and Royal Children's Hospital in Neuro-Oncology, Toronto Western Hospital in Stereotactic and Functional Neurosurgery and Hospital for Sick Children (Toronto) in Paediatric Neurosurgery. He was also a Sugita Fellow and Visiting Scholar at Nagoya University.
